How to Make a Swan Out of a Towel: A Step-by-Step Guide

Folding towels, also known as towel origami, is a fun and creative way to make a regular towel into a pretty decoration. One of the most popular design is the beautiful swan. With its long, curved neck and spread-out wings, a swan made out of a towel makes a stylish addition to any bathroom or linen closet.

Gathering Supplies

To begin, gather the following supplies:

  1. One medium or large-sized towel
  2. Rubber bands
  3. Safety pins (optional)

Make sure your towel is in good condition and clean.

Step-by-Step Process

Now that you have your materials ready, let’s go through the step-by-step process.

Step 1: Folding the Towel for Swan Body

  1. Lay the towel flat on a clean and flat surface.
  1. Fold it in half diagonally to form a triangle, ensuring the corners align.
  1. Smooth out any wrinkles to create a neat triangle shape.

Step 2: Forming the Swan’s Neck and Head

  1. Roll the left side of the folded edge towards the middle of the triangle, forming a long, thin neck.
  1. Roll the right side of the folded edge towards the middle, following the line of the neck.
  1. Fold the pointed end of the neck upwards to create the swan’s head.
  1. Shape the head by gently curving the folded edges.

Step 3: Shaping the Wings

  1. Unfold the two flaps at the bottom of the triangle (the swan’s body).
  1. Fold each flap inwards, creating two wings.
  1. Adjust the wings by pulling them outwards and angling them upwards for a graceful pose.

Step 4: Adding Details

To give your swan some added flair, you can incorporate a few extra touches:

  1. Use safety pins or decorative pins to secure the wings in place. This will help keep the shape of the wings intact.
  1. To make a beak, take a small towel and roll it into a cone shape. Attach the cone to the front of the swan’s head using a safety pin.
  1. Use additional pins to create eyes for the swan, or use small decorative gems or buttons.

Step 5: Final Touches

Take a step back and assess your towel swan. Adjust any folds or positions as needed to achieve the desired look. Smooth out any wrinkles and make sure all the details are secure.

Tips and Troubleshooting

  • Practice: It might not be perfect on your first try, so practice until you master it.
  • Use Pins: If the wings don’t hold their shape, use safety pins to secure them more firmly.
  • Size Matters: The towel’s size determines the swan’s final dimensions, so choose your towel wisely.

What is towel origami?

Towel origami is the art of folding towels into different shapes, such as animals, objects, and decorations. It is a fun and creative way to add a personal touch to your home décor. This is also a great activity for children, as it helps them develop their skills.

What is towel art called?

Towel art is another term used to describe the practice of folding towels into decorative shapes. It’s a broader term that encompasses towel origami, towel sculptures, and other folding techniques for artistic expression.
